LDTViewer Review: Features, Pros, and Cons
Overview
LDTViewer is a lightweight tool for viewing, inspecting, and rotating 3D models and engineering drawings. It focuses on quick rendering, straightforward navigation, and compatibility with common model formats. This review summarizes its key features, evaluates strengths and weaknesses, and suggests who will benefit most from the tool.
Key Features
- Format support: Opens common 3D file formats (e.g., OBJ, STL, and COLLADA), with basic handling for texture and material data.
- Rendering performance: Fast, hardware-accelerated rendering designed for smooth navigation of medium-complexity models.
- Navigation tools: Orbit, pan, zoom, and preset camera views; mouse and keyboard shortcuts for rapid inspection.
- Measurement tools: Distance and angle measurement between model vertices or selected points.
- Layer and visibility controls: Toggle model parts or layers on/off for focused inspection.
- Annotation and snapshot: Add simple annotations and export high-resolution snapshots for documentation.
- Lightweight interface: Minimal UI with an emphasis on viewing rather than editing; low system resource usage.
- Cross-platform availability: Desktop builds for Windows, macOS, and Linux; some versions include a web-based viewer.
Pros
- Fast and responsive: Efficient rendering even on modest hardware.
- Easy to learn: Intuitive controls and minimal setup make it accessible for non-experts.
- Low resource usage: Suitable for quick inspections on older machines or in constrained environments.
- Good format coverage for viewers: Supports the most common exchange formats used in 3D printing and CAD review.
- Useful measurement tools: Built-in measurements are handy for quick checks without opening a full CAD package.
Cons
- Limited editing capabilities: Not suitable for model creation or detailed modifications.
- Advanced rendering lacking: No advanced shading, physically based rendering, or high-end visualization effects.
- Partial format fidelity: Complex textures, animations, or proprietary format features may not import perfectly.
- Feature gaps for power users: Lacks advanced analysis tools (e.g., mesh repair, simulation, or CAD-level constraints).
- Inconsistent web experience: Browser-based viewer can be slower or lack features compared to desktop builds.
Who Should Use LDTViewer
- Designers and engineers who need a fast way to inspect models without launching heavy CAD software.
- 3D printing hobbyists needing quick file checks and measurements.
- Reviewers and managers who require fast snapshots and annotations for feedback loops.
- Educators and students for demonstrations where editing isn’t required.
Recommendations
- Use LDTViewer as a fast inspection tool in a workflow that pairs it with a full CAD or mesh-editing application for changes.
- Verify critical dimensions and textures by cross-checking in a native CAD viewer if your format includes proprietary features.
- Prefer the desktop version for smoother performance and full feature access; use the web viewer for quick sharing when needed.
Conclusion
LDTViewer delivers a focused, efficient viewing experience: excellent for quick inspections, measurements, and documentation. It’s not a replacement for full-featured CAD or mesh-editing software, but it fills the niche of a fast, low-overhead model viewer well—ideal for users who prioritize speed and simplicity over advanced editing and visualization.
